Description:
The web site says that it is possible to use other toolchains besides <jdk>.
Actually the site links to a nonexistent TBD page. This is very ugly.
Please tell the truth on the web page: It is simply impossible to use any other
toolschain type besides <jdk>!
It would be really cool, if someone could simply write:
{code:xml}
<toolchains>
<type>installshield</type>
<provides>
<id>isx</id>
<version>10.0</version>
<vendor>macrovision</vendor>
</provides>
<configuration>
<installshieldHome>C:\Program Files (x86)\InstallShield
X</installshieldHome>
</configuration>
</toolchains>
{code}
...and the plugin would in turn simply provide a property that one can read in
the POM using ${installshieldHome} -- without any need to write Java code,
register custom types, provide more xml, whatever!
This seems to be such an obvious need that I just cannot believe that it does
not already work exactly that way in the 1.0 release of the toolchains
plugin...! :-)
I really beg for that! :-)
